Consolidated Net Income
The total net income of a parent company and its subsidiaries after removing the effects of intercompany transactions.
Impairment
A reduction in the recoverable value of a fixed asset or goodwill below its carrying amount on the balance sheet.
Dividends
Dividends are a portion of a company's earnings that are distributed to its shareholders as a reward for their investment.
Impairment Loss
A charge against earnings representing the amount by which the carrying amount of an asset exceeds its recoverable amount.
